1. First, start them out by sending the So You Just Joined The Team link to them in their Success Chat. I like to change the title of Success Chat to SUCCESS Chat (with all caps) to indicate a Customer who is also now sharing so that all coaches in the group will know at a glance that that person is interested in the business.
2. Now, get your new Distributor sharing. Teach her exactly how to post to her FB wall as soon as possible, using the Sharing link as a guide. Also show her how to invite all her friends to Fly on the Wall if she hasn’t yet.
3. Show your new Distributor how to respond to queries she gets on her first FB post. Use the Responding link to teach her.
4. Get your brand new Distributor added to our Newbies Chat on Facebook. Ask your coach if you need help.
5. Make sure your new Distributor signs up for our Text Blast by texting @teammc to 81010 on her cell phone. If she has Verizon or lives in Canada, let her know she needs to download the Remind App to her phone instead and uses Class Code @teammc to join.
6. Tell your new Distributor about trainings like JV Live and Nine@Nine. It is also your job to let your new Distributor know about Fast Four and hitting Manager!
7. Keep track of your Distributor’s Quick Start Bonus progress! Tell them what this is, count them down for their first four New Starts of 120 points or more, and celebrate them each step of the way!
8. Finally, put your Distributors on the phone regularly with an upline for Inspire Calls. The first day a Distributor upgrades, ask your Coach to meet the new Distributor on the phone quick for some encouragement and a fast start.
Your team will only grow as much as you help your new Distributors to grow, so make sure to hold their hands in the beginning and teach them all of these things and more!
